Mechanisms of Cognitive Enhancement
The application of sound therapy for cognitive enhancement revolves around several mechanisms:
- Brainwave Entrainment: Different frequencies of sound can entrain brainwaves, influencing mental states such as relaxation (alpha waves), focus (beta waves), creativity (theta waves), and deep relaxation (delta waves). By exposing the brain to specific frequencies, sound therapy aims to induce desired cognitive states.
- Neuroplasticity: The brain’s ability to reorganize itself by forming new neural connections is crucial for learning and memory. Sound therapy may facilitate neuroplasticity by promoting synaptic plasticity, enhancing learning capacity, and supporting cognitive flexibility.
- Stress Reduction: Chronic stress can impair cognitive function by affecting memory, attention, and decision-making abilities. Sound therapy techniques, such as listening to calming music or nature sounds, can reduce stress hormone levels (e.g., cortisol) and promote a relaxed state conducive to cognitive performance.
- Emotional Regulation: Sound therapy can modulate emotional responses by influencing the limbic system, which plays a key role in regulating emotions. Music, in particular, has been used therapeutically to enhance mood, reduce anxiety, and improve emotional resilience—all of which contribute to better cognitive function.
Applications in Cognitive Enhancement
Sound therapy interventions for cognitive enhancement can take various forms:
- Binaural Beats: These auditory illusions involve presenting two slightly different frequencies to each ear, causing the brain to perceive a third frequency. Binaural beats are believed to synchronize brainwaves and promote specific mental states, such as relaxation or focus.
- Music Therapy: Guided by trained therapists, music therapy utilizes structured musical experiences to address cognitive, emotional, and social needs. Customized playlists or improvisational sessions can help individuals improve attention, memory, and communication skills.
- Soundscapes and Ambient Sounds: Natural sounds like ocean waves, raindrops, or bird songs can evoke a sense of tranquility and reduce cognitive load, thereby enhancing concentration and cognitive clarity.
- Mindfulness Meditation with Sound: Incorporating sound into mindfulness practices can deepen meditative states and enhance cognitive resilience. Sound bowls, gongs, or chanting may accompany meditation sessions to foster relaxation and mental clarity.
